Do You Satisfy the Requirements for Phlebotomist Training?

Although there are not many requirements in instruction to become a Phlebotomist, you must pay attention to the ones that do exist. One must have graduated from high school or have a GED or equivalent, be the legal age to work in Kentucky, pass a criminal background investigation, and lastly you must pass a test for drugs to be qualified for enrollment.
